June 23, 2023 marked the 38th anniversary of the deadliest terror attack on Canadian citizens in the country’s history.

But a new poll has revealed Canadians know little about the National Day of Remembrance for Victims of Terrorism and the Air India bombings it was created to honour.

On June 23, 1985, 329 passengers and crew, 268 of them Canadians, were killed when a bomb went off on Air India Flight 182. A second bomb killed two baggage handlers in Japan. Both attacks were tied to a B.C.-based terrorist group seeking an independent Sikh state in India.
